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Placerville to Fremont is to drive which costs $23 - $35 and takes 2h 37m.
The fastest way to get from Placerville to Fremont is to drive which takes 2h 37m and costs $23 - $35.
The distance between Placerville and Fremont is 160 miles. The road distance is 127.1 miles.
The best way to get from Placerville to Fremont without a car is to bus and train via Sacramento which takes 4h 41m and costs $50 - $70.
It takes approximately 4h 41m to get from Placerville to Fremont, including transfers.
Yes, the driving distance between Placerville to Fremont is 127 miles. It takes approximately 2h 37m to drive from Placerville to Fremont.
